Transaction ed2aeeedc2f29ad7c620ea92856ff811542bb339cc03245c0da697b709c44d3e
1 Input
2 Outputs
- ed2aeeedc2f29ad7c620ea92856ff811542bb339cc03245c0da697b709c44d3e:0
- ed2aeeedc2f29ad7c620ea92856ff811542bb339cc03245c0da697b709c44d3e:1
value 581591
address 1KRYksMLUGNazzPZZurPsMqFozCfMpvUza
value 23135780
address 14FY8rc3c4abJZVbUHQocGaqh18DikEZ7f